CEC2021单目标有约束优化问题测试函数集代码发布
版权申诉

知识点1:CEC2021测试函数集
CEC2021测试函数集是针对单目标有约束优化问题设计的一系列基准测试函数。这些函数广泛用于评估和比较不同优化算法的性能。测试函数集通常包含一系列具有不同特性的函数,这些特性可能包括多峰值、非线性、多维、等式与不等式约束等。通过这些具有代表性的测试函数,研究者们可以测试和验证他们的算法在面对各种问题时的稳定性和有效性。
知识点2:单目标有约束优化问题
单目标有约束优化问题是指在满足一定约束条件的前提下,寻求使得某个单一目标函数值最小化或最大化的解的问题。在实际应用中,例如工程设计、经济管理、机器学习等领域,经常会遇到需要解决此类问题的情况。约束条件可以是等式约束也可以是不等式约束,它们定义了问题的可行解空间。这类问题的求解通常要比无约束问题复杂,因为它需要在可行域内寻找最优解。
知识点3:C版本和Matlab版本代码
在科学计算和工程应用领域,C语言和Matlab都是非常重要的编程语言。C语言以其高性能而著称,非常适合实现算法原型和系统级开发。Matlab则因其易于编程和强大的数值计算能力而在算法研究和原型开发中应用广泛。该测试函数集提供了C语言版本和Matlab版本的代码实现,这使得研究人员可以根据自己的工作环境和习惯选择合适的语言进行算法测试和开发。
知识点4:pdf说明文件
PDF格式文件因其跨平台兼容性和良好的文档格式稳定性,广泛应用于学术文档和研究报告的分享。在测试函数集中包含pdf格式的说明文件,可以方便用户理解每个测试函数的具体特性和应用场景。这些说明文件通常会详细描述每个函数的数学表达式、参数范围、解的约束条件以及可能的全局最优解等信息。
知识点5:文件名称列表分析
- "新建文件夹"这一项可能表示的是压缩包内含有一个用于存放相关文件的文件夹,以便用户更好地组织和管理下载的内容。
- "2021-SO-BCO-main"很可能是对应测试函数集的主要文件夹,其中可能包含了所有关于CEC2021单目标有约束优化问题的测试函数文件、代码实现以及相关文档。
- "G"和"H"两个文件夹的具体内容无法直接通过文件名得知,它们可能是按照某种分类方式或者项目结构来划分的文件夹,里面可能分别存放了特定的测试函数、代码或者其他类型的文档资料。
总结来说,CEC2021 测试函数集提供了丰富的基准问题,用于测试和提升单目标有约束优化算法的性能。这些基准问题具有广泛的科学和工程应用场景,能够帮助研究人员和开发者对他们的优化算法进行准确有效的评估。通过提供C语言和Matlab两种流行的编程语言实现,这套测试函数集能够适用于不同的开发环境。同时,包含的说明文档可以帮助用户更好地理解和运用这些测试函数。
点击了解资源详情
2024-10-26 上传
159 浏览量
2023-04-21 上传
111 浏览量
134 浏览量

GZM888888
- 粉丝: 690
最新资源
- 深入探讨V2C控制Buck变换器稳定性分析及仿真验证
- 2012款途观怡利导航破解方法及多图功能实现
- Vue.js图表库vuetrend:简洁优雅的动态数据展示
- 提升效率:仓库管理系统中的算法与数据结构设计
- Matlab入门必读教程——快速上手指南
- NARRA项目可视化工具集 - JavaScript框架解析
- 小蜜蜂天气预报查询系统:PHP源码与前端后端应用
- JVM运行机制深入解析教程
- MATLAB分子结构绘制源代码免费分享
- 掌握MySQL 5:《权威指南》第三版中文版
- Swift框架:QtC++打造的易用Web服务器解决方案
- 实现对话框控件自适应的多种效果
- 白镇奇士推出DBF转EXCEL高效工具:hap-dbf2xls-hyy
- 构建简易TCP路由器的代码开发指南
- ElasticSearch架构与应用实战教程
- MyBatis自动生成MySQL映射文件教程